使用spring-data-ldap的基礎用法,定義LDAP中屬性與我們Java中定義實體的關系映射以及對應的Repository @Data @Entry(base = "ou=people,dc=didispace,dc=com", objectClasses ...
從上一篇 將Mybatis引入Spring Boot項目連接數據庫操作 知道了如何在Spring Boot項目操作數據庫,學會了增刪查改基本操作方法。本節記錄如何從Ldap獲取組織結構及用戶信息並導入數據庫。 一,引入Maven依賴並設置ldap連接信息 首先在pom.xml添加引入ldap依賴,如下所示: 保存后等待自動加載插件,加載完成后在application.properties配置文件 ...
2020-06-16 19:47 0 2176 推薦指數:
使用spring-data-ldap的基礎用法,定義LDAP中屬性與我們Java中定義實體的關系映射以及對應的Repository @Data @Entry(base = "ou=people,dc=didispace,dc=com", objectClasses ...
LDAP簡介 LDAP(輕量級目錄訪問協議,Lightweight Directory Access Protocol)是實現提供被稱為目錄服務的信息服務。目錄服務是一種特殊的數據庫系統,其專門針對讀取,瀏覽和搜索操作進行了特定的優化。目錄一般用來包含描述性的,基於屬性的信息並支持精細復雜的過濾 ...
很多時候,我們在做公司系統或產品時,都需要自己創建用戶管理體系,這對於開發人員來說並不是什么難事,但是當我們需要維護多個不同系統並且相同用戶跨系統使用的情況下,如果每個系統維護自己的用戶信息,那么此時用戶信息的同步就會變的比較麻煩,對於用戶自身來說也會非常困擾,很容易出現不同系統密碼不一致 ...
因為工作需求近期做過一個從客戶AD域獲取數據實現單點登錄的功能,在此整理分享。 前提:用戶可能有很多系統的情況下,為了方便賬號的統一管理使用AD域驗證登錄,所以不需要我們的系統登錄,就需要獲取用戶的AD域組織和用戶信息,實現域認證和單點登錄。 LDAP: LDAP是輕量目錄訪問協議 ...
很多企業內部使用LDAP保存用戶信息,這章我們來看一下如何從LDAP中獲取Spring Security所需的用戶信息。 首先在pom.xml中添加ldap所需的依賴。 <dependency> <groupId> ...
一. 代碼層結構 根目錄:com.example.demo 1.啟動類(gApplication.java)推薦放在根目錄com.example.demo包下 2.實體類(domain) 3.數據接口訪問層(Dao) 4.數據服務接口層(Service)推薦 ...
項目結構介紹 如上圖所示,Spring Boot 的基礎結構共三個文件,具體如下: src/main/java:程序開發以及主程序入口; src/main/resources:配置文件; src/test/java:測試程序。 另外,Spring Boot 建議的目錄 ...
示例准備 打開上一篇文章配置好的AD域控制器 開始菜單-->管理工具-->Active Directory 用戶和計算機 新建組織單位和用戶 新建層次關系 ...